I have just installed a GTX 1050 in my rig and found that seti now ignores my GTX 980. Am I missing a tweak that will allow seti use both gpu's ? 03/02/2017 18:46:26 | | CUDA: NVIDIA GPU 0 (not used): GeForce GTX 980 Ti (driver version 378.49, CUDA version 8.0, compute capability 5.2, 4096MB, 3962MB available, 6916 GFLOPS peak) 03/02/2017 18:46:26 | | CUDA: NVIDIA GPU 1: GeForce GTX 1050 Ti (driver version 378.49, CUDA version 8.0, compute capability 6.1, 4096MB, 3404MB available, 2138 GFLOPS peak) 03/02/2017 18:46:26 | | OpenCL: NVIDIA GPU 0 (not used): GeForce GTX 980 Ti (driver version 378.49, device version OpenCL 1.2 CUDA, 6144MB, 3962MB available, 6916 GFLOPS peak) 03/02/2017 18:46:26 | | OpenCL: NVIDIA GPU 1: GeForce GTX 1050 Ti (driver version 378.49, device version OpenCL 1.2 CUDA, 4096MB, 3404MB available, 2138 GFLOPS peak) |
Brent Norman Send message Joined: 1 Dec 99 Posts: 2786 Credit: 685,657,289 RAC: 835 |
in cc_config.xml add: <use_all_gpus>1</use_all_gpus> |
